tag, ich hab mir mal erlaubt einen javascript zu coden, mit dem man auf einer seite blättern kann, ohne mehrere files benutzen zu müssen (php mal ausgelassen ^^)

der javascript:
Code:
<script>
var old_id = 'null';

function show(id)
{
    if(old_id == 'null') {
        old_id = 1;
    }
    document.getElementById(old_id).style.display = 'none';
    old_id = id;

    document.getElementById(id).style.display = 'block';
}
</scrip>

das ganze geht natürlich auch noch nobler, aber so viel ahnung von js hjab ich noch ned...

jetzt müsst ihr nurnoch ein paar links erstellen, in denen die id von den divs sitzt, die dann als content angezeigt werden (hört sich kompliziert an, isses aber garnicht mal so)

Code:
<a href="#top" onclick="show('1')">Startseite</a><a href="#top" onclick="show('2')">2. Seite</a>
<div id="1" class="main" style="display:block;">Tagchen.</div><div id="2" class="main">Jo.


okay, soweit so gut. bei dem code oben seht ihr nun bei dem 'div' mit der id="1" ein style="display:block;", das bewirkt, dass der 1. div sofort angezeigt wird.
(der javascript bewirkt im wirklichen nur, dass die alten divs nicht mehr angezeigt werden und dafür ein neuer)

nunr sind wir ja fast fertig, doch eins fehlt noch.
wir müssen 2 zeilen über der navigation mit den links einen anker einfügen, auf den wir dann zugreifen, wenn wir auf einen link klicken ansonsten würde und das ganz immer wieder nach oben rutschen.

der endliche code:
Code:
<script src="http://famboot.fa.funpic.de/knuddels.js"></script>
<link href="http://famboot.fa.funpic.de/knuddels.css" rel="stylesheet">
<a name="top" style="border:0px; background-color:none;"></a>



<a href="#top" onclick="show('1')">Startseite</a><a href="#top" onclick="show('2')">2. Seite</a>
<div id="1" class="main" style="display:block;">Tagchen.
</div><div id="2" class="main">Jo.</div>


wobei ich mir bei dem code meinen css extern eingebunden hab und den javascript auch. (<script src="..."></script>, <link...>).
den css solltet ihr natürlich auch verändern sonst siehts so aus wie auf meiner hp ^^ (was mich nicht stört, weil eh mein zeichen drauf hockt ^^) und dann natürlich noch euren inhalt in die divs.
ps: den javascript extern einzubinden ist eine ganz gute lösung, da es zu komplikationen kommen kan, da knuddels ja in jeder neuen zeile ein <br> einfügt (meiner meinung nach quatsch..!)

ich hoff, alles passt so wie ichs gesagt hab und einfach schön rumprobieren! irgendwann könnt ihr das was ich hier gemachthab dann mit leichtigkeit! ;)